Shane said that the SeamMultipartFilter has been replaced with a universal Seam 
filter, but in the s:fileUpload section in 1.1.7 RC1 docs, the 
SeamMultipartFilter is still there: For multipart requests, the Seam Multipart 
servlet filter must also be configured in web.xml:
  | 
  |                  
  |     <filter>
  |         <filter-name>Seam Multipart Filter</filter-name>
  |         
<filter-class>org.jboss.seam.servlet.SeamMultipartFilter</filter-class>
  |     </filter>
  |     
  |     <filter-mapping>
  |         <filter-name>Seam Multipart Filter</filter-name>
  |         <url-pattern>*.seam</url-pattern>
  |     </filter-mapping>  Should it be replaced by     <filter>
  |       <filter-name>Seam Filter</filter-name>
  |       <filter-class>org.jboss.seam.web.SeamFilter</filter-class>
  |     </filter>
  |     
  |     <filter-mapping>
  |       <filter-name>Seam Filter</filter-name>
  |       <url-pattern>/*</url-pattern>
  |     </filter-mapping> 
In addition, it seems that s:fileUpload attributes missed the fileSize 
attribute in 1.1.7 docs of s:fileUpload section.
